​D.C. United v Charlotte FC: Lesesne says hosts´ confidence is sky excessive

Troy Lesesne believes D.C. United’s confidence is as excessive because it has been all season forward of their essential Choice-Day assembly with Charlotte FC.

D.C. want some extent to clinch a playoff place for the primary time since 2019, which might finish their joint-longest playoff drought (additionally 4 years between 2008 and 2011).

They’re in competition with CF Montreal and the Philadelphia Union, with two wild-card spots nonetheless to be selected the ultimate matchday within the Japanese Convention, after recording back-to-back victories over Nashville SC (4-3) and the New England Revolution (2-1).

“When challenges come – and we’ve had many this yr – it’s straightforward for us to make use of these as excuses and pack it up,” Lesesne informed reporters.

“However our group has by no means performed that, simply take a look at all of the issues we’ve gone by way of this yr, the psychological endurance that these guys have exhibited to be on this place…

“You study a lot about your self and your gamers and I’m actually happy with the group.

“You anticipated all alongside that it could go proper right down to the final sport, however the confidence of this crew proper now appears to be on the highest it has been all yr.”

Charlotte, however, have already confirmed their postseason spot, although a victory may see them transfer from sixth to fifth and enhance their playoff seeding.

“I do know this sport is extra for seeding than the rest, however the primary factor for us is to maintain this going,” ahead Patrick Agyemang mentioned.

“The primary factor is to simply proceed on the highway we’re on, which is optimistic outcomes. We wish the season to finish with a bang to place us in a very good place for the playoffs.”

PLAYERS TO WATCH

D.C. United – Christian Benteke

Benteke has scored 23 targets this season, equalling Raul Diaz Arce (1996) for essentially the most in a single season in D.C.’s MLS historical past.

His 9 headed targets, in the meantime, are tied for the second-most in a single yr by any participant since Opta started detailed knowledge assortment of MLS in 2010, behind Josef Martinez’s 10 in 2018. Can he draw stage with the Venezuelan?

Charlotte FC – Patrick Agyemang

Agyemang’s aim for Charlotte final Saturday, in a 2-0 win over Montreal, was his fifteenth aim contribution of the season (9 targets, six assists).

He’s one aim contribution shy of the single-season membership file of 16, achieved by Karol Swiderski in every of the crew’s first two MLS campaigns.

MATCH PREDICTION – DRAW

The house facet has not misplaced any of the 5 earlier conferences between D.C. and Charlotte, with D.C. recording a pair of 3-0 wins of their two residence matches in opposition to the Crown.

Charlotte, although, have misplaced solely 4 of their final 11 regular-season away matches relationship again to the start of Could (4 wins, three attracts).

D.C. United solely want some extent to qualify for the playoffs for the primary time since 2019, ending a four-year postseason drought, and with residence benefit on their facet, they need to get it.

OPTA WIN PROBABILITY

D.C. United – 37.1%

Charlotte FC – 36.6%

Draw – 26.3%
